Thank you, Myrna Davis Brown for telling our story in such an informative way. The February 3, 2026 episode of The World and Everything In It features a story about members of the DAR exercising their member rights to take the historic, women’s only genealogical society back from trans-ideology.

My favorite part is when attorney Randall Wenger, Chief Counsel for the Independence Law Center validated what we have been saying all along… and what the now Assistant Attorney General Harmeet K. Dhillon said her legal memo provided by her nonprofit, The Center for American Libertywe are NOT in jeopardy of losing our tax exempt status over this issue!

Randall Wenger, Chief Counsel for the Independence Law Center said:

“An organization like the Daughters of the American Revolution is not at risk of losing tax-exempt status by refusing membership to men, even if those men identify as women.”

Ms. Brown reports that Mr. Wenger says that because the DAR was founded as a sex-separated organization, it has legal protections that allow it to limit membership accordingly. He says organizations that have lost tax-exemption took extreme positions on public policy.

“But women’s groups, especially those involved in expression on women’s issues are not contrary to public policy.”
